Output 84322babae71cbad6bb991a5ed16c44a987dfd0d7b7909dcd85ef66a2b034889:0

value
102600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c268040722337e497a2ca89e8839fbfb6675ba OP_EQUAL
address
37n1QntA4GC2ZxUmetV9zqxKYmPx8W96LP
transaction
84322babae71cbad6bb991a5ed16c44a987dfd0d7b7909dcd85ef66a2b034889
spent
true